Configuring the TURN relay service for WebRTC calls on Avaya Session Border Controller

Last Updated : Oct 04, 2018 |

Procedure

  1. Log in to the Avaya SBC web administration interface.
  2. Navigate to Device Specific Settings > TURN/STUN Service.
  3. From the Application pane, select the Avaya SBC device for which you need to create a new TURN relay service.
  4. Click TURN/STUN Relay.
  5. Click Add.

    The system displays the Add TURN/STUN IP Pairing window.

  6. In Listen IP, provide the listen IP address of the TURN server from the B1 interface.
    Important:

    Do not use this IP address for any other interface bound to port 443.

  7. In Media Relay, provide the media relay IP address of the TURN server from the internal A1 interface that you used for load monitoring.
  8. In Service FQDN, provide the FQDN that resolves to the address specified in the Listen IP field.

    For example, turnmedia.company.com.

  9. In TURN/STUN Profile, select the TURN/STUN profile that you created for WebRTC calls.
  10. Complete the following fields:
    1. In TURN/STUN Profile, select the TURN/STUN profile that you created for WebRTC calls.

      For example: turnProfileForWebrtcCalls. For more information, see Configuring a TURN/STUN profile for WebRTC calls on Avaya Session Border Controller.

  11. Click Finish.
